Teacher of History

Contract Length: 6 months
Pay: £150.00 - £250.00 per day

Hours:

15-37.5 per week

Location:

Leicester

We are seeking a dedicated and passionate Teacher of History to join a secondary school in Leicester. This is an excellent opportunity for a committed educator to deliver engaging History lessons while supporting students' academic achievement and personal development in a positive, inclusive environment.

Key Responsibilities
  • Plan, prepare, and deliver high-quality History lessons in line with the national curriculum (KS3-KS4; KS5 desirable)
  • Assess, monitor, and report on student progress, providing clear and constructive feedback
  • Create a stimulating classroom environment that encourages critical thinking and curiosity
  • Maintain accurate records of attendance, attainment, and behaviour
  • Adapt teaching strategies to meet diverse learning needs
  • Contribute to departmental collaboration, curriculum development, and enrichment activities
  • Communicate effectively with parents/carers and uphold school policies and safeguarding standards
Requirements
  • Recognised teaching qualification (QTS preferred) or relevant educational degree
  • Previous teaching or tutoring experience desirable
  • Strong subject knowledge in History
  • Excellent classroom management and organisational skills
  • Ability to motivate and inspire students of varying abilities
